About Phu Khiao

Phu Khiao is a small city in Thailand (Chaiyaphum) with a population of 17,122. The city sits at an elevation of 699 feet (213 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 80°F (27°C). Temperatures range from 73°F in January to 82°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 38.8 inches. The timezone is Asia/Bangkok.

Climate in Phu Khiao

Phu Khiao has an average annual temperature of 24.9°C (77°F). The hottest month is Apr (28.8°C), the coldest is Dec (19.6°C). Average annual precipitation is 1346 mm.

Month Avg °C / °F Min / Max °C Rain (mm)
Jan 21.1°C / 70°F 10.5° / 31.1° 3.4
Feb 24.3°C / 76°F 13.3° / 35° 17.6
Mar 27.6°C / 82°F 17.2° / 38° 58.2
Apr 28.8°C / 84°F 19.8° / 39.9° 83.2
May 27.9°C / 82°F 21.3° / 38.2° 155.3
Jun 26.5°C / 80°F 21.8° / 34.3° 129.1
Jul 25.9°C / 79°F 21.7° / 32.8° 199.8
Aug 25.6°C / 78°F 21.4° / 32° 224.9
Sep 25.3°C / 78°F 20.9° / 30.9° 314.9
Oct 23.9°C / 75°F 17.1° / 30.3° 143.4
Nov 22.5°C / 72°F 14.3° / 30.1° 15.4
Dec 19.6°C / 67°F 8.5° / 29.3° 0.9
